She has $1.2 billion in record sales and other revenues.

Quote:
One of the top pop divas of all time, Madonna has grossed an estimated $1.2 billion on the road in her career.
The Material Girl has been credited with influencing female musicians from Britney Spears to Shakira to Lady Gaga.
Her new album, 'Madame X,' due out in June, is her 14th studio album.
Her Madame X tour, an intimate theater-only affair, begins in September in New York.
